DTC P1574 ASCD VEHICLE SPEED SENSORComponent Description
The ECM receives two vehicle speed sensor signals via CAN communication line. One is sent from "unified meter and A/C amp.", and the other is from TCM (Transmission control module). The ECM uses these signals for ASCD control. Refer to EC-615 for ASCD functions. Automatic Speed Control Device (ASCD)
On Board Diagnosis Logic
This self-diagnosis has the one trip detection logic.
The MIL will not light up for this diagnosis.
NOTE:
- If DTC P1574 is displayed with DTC U1000, U1001, first perform the trouble diagnosis for DTC U1000, U1001. Refer to EC-724. U1000
- If DTC P1574 is displayed with DTC U1010, first perform the trouble diagnosis for DTC U1010. Refer to EC-726. U1010
- If DTC P1574 is displayed with DTC P0500, first perform the trouble diagnosis for DTC P0500. Refer to EC-992 P0500
- If DTC P1574 is displayed with DTC P0605, first perform the trouble diagnosis for DTC P0605. Refer to EC-1007 P0605
DTC Confirmation Procedure
CAUTION: Always drive vehicle at a safe speed.
NOTE: If DTC Confirmation Procedure has been previously conducted, always turn ignition switch OFF and wait at least 10 seconds before conducting the next test.
TESTING CONDITION:
Step 3 may be conducted with the drive wheels lifted in the shop or by driving the vehicle. If a road test is expected to be easier, it is unnecessary to lift the vehicle.
1. Start engine (VDC switch OFF).
2. Drive the vehicle at more than 40 km/h (25 MPH).
3. Check DTC.
4. If DTC is detected, go to "Diagnosis Procedure".
